How To:Mechanical Code Change

 

 

Standard Mechanical Code Change

This video demonstrates how to perform a code change using the off-door method on standard mechanical Codelocks. It's applicable to the following lock models:

  • CL50
  • CL100 range (excluding the CL160 QuickCode)
  • CL200 range
  • CL400 range
  • CL500 range

 

Important Notes

  • The silver 'C' tumbler must always be used as the first digit of a code. Never remove the 'C' tumbler.
  • Buttons may only be used once in a code. For example, 1212 is not possible.
  • The 'C' button must be kept depressed throughout the tumbler repositioning process. Failure to do so will result in damage to the internal mechanisms.
  • The square notches of all tumblers must face outwards, with the square tips at the top.


We recommend watching the video once through and familiarising yourself with the process before starting.
